数据库建表都有什么作用

不及物动词 其他 13

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库建表的作用有以下几个方面:

    1. 存储和组织数据:数据库建表是为了存储和组织数据而创建的。通过建立表,可以将数据按照不同的类别和属性进行分类和管理,使得数据的存储更加有序和结构化。

    2. 数据的持久化:数据库建表可以将数据持久化保存,即使系统或应用程序关闭,数据仍然可以被保留和访问。这样可以确保数据的安全性和可靠性,避免数据的丢失和损坏。

    3. 数据的查询和检索:通过数据库建表,可以使用SQL语言来查询和检索数据。数据库的设计和表的建立可以根据需求进行优化,使得数据的查询和检索更加高效和方便。

    4. 数据的更新和修改:数据库建表可以对数据进行更新和修改。通过对表的结构和字段进行调整,可以实现对数据的增加、删除和修改,保证数据的完整性和一致性。

    5. 数据的共享和共享:数据库建表可以实现数据的共享和共享。不同的应用程序和系统可以通过访问数据库中的表来共享和共享数据,提高数据的利用率和共享性。

    总之,数据库建表是数据库设计的重要环节,它的作用是为了存储、组织、查询、更新和共享数据,从而实现数据的持久化和管理。通过合理设计和建立表,可以提高数据的安全性、可靠性和利用率,满足不同应用场景下的数据管理需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库建表是数据库设计的重要一环,它的作用主要有以下几点:

    1. 数据结构化:建表可以将数据按照一定的结构进行组织和存储,使得数据更加有序、易于管理和操作。通过建表,可以定义数据表的字段及其数据类型,规定数据的存储格式和约束条件,从而实现数据的结构化存储。

    2. 数据存储:建表将数据存储在数据库中,实现数据的持久化存储。数据库是一个可靠的数据存储介质,通过建表将数据存储在数据库中,可以保证数据的安全性和可靠性。

    3. 数据查询:建表可以为数据提供高效的查询功能。通过建立索引、定义主键和外键等约束,可以加快数据的查询速度和提高查询的准确性。建表时还可以定义视图、触发器和存储过程等数据库对象,进一步扩展查询的功能。

    4. 数据一致性:建表可以通过定义各种约束条件,保证数据的一致性。例如,通过设置主键、唯一约束和外键约束,可以避免数据的重复和不一致。建表还可以定义检查约束,限制数据的取值范围,确保数据的有效性和一致性。

    5. 数据安全性:建表可以通过设置权限和访问控制,确保数据的安全性。通过建立角色、用户和权限等,可以控制用户对数据表的操作权限,保护敏感数据的安全。

    总之,数据库建表是数据库设计的重要环节,它通过定义数据结构、存储数据、提供查询功能、保证数据一致性和安全性,实现对数据的有效管理和利用。合理的数据库建表可以提高数据的组织性、查询效率和安全性,为应用程序提供可靠的数据支持。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库建表是指在关系型数据库中创建数据表的过程。它的作用主要有以下几个方面:

    1. 存储数据:数据库建表的首要作用是用于存储数据。在创建表时,我们会定义表的结构,包括表的列和数据类型。每个表的行代表一个记录,每个列代表一个属性。通过将数据存储在表中,我们可以方便地对数据进行增删改查等操作。

    2. 组织数据:数据库建表可以帮助我们组织数据,使其具有结构化的特点。通过将数据按照不同的表进行分类和存储,我们可以更好地管理数据。例如,可以创建不同的表来存储用户信息、订单信息、产品信息等。这样可以使数据更有条理,方便查询和管理。

    3. 约束数据完整性:在数据库建表时,我们可以定义各种约束来保证数据的完整性。例如,可以定义主键约束来确保每条记录的唯一性;可以定义外键约束来保证表与表之间的关联关系;可以定义唯一约束来保证某一列的值的唯一性等。通过约束,可以有效地控制和保护数据的准确性和一致性。

    4. 提高查询效率:数据库建表时,我们可以根据数据的特点和需求来设计表的结构。通过合理的表设计,可以提高查询效率。例如,可以根据经常查询的字段来创建索引,加快查询速度;可以将数据拆分为多个表,降低数据冗余和查询的复杂度等。

    5. 支持数据分析和决策:数据库建表可以为数据分析和决策提供支持。通过合理设计表的结构,可以方便地进行数据分析和统计。例如,可以通过查询语句对数据进行聚合、分组和排序等操作,得出有价值的信息。这对于企业的决策和业务发展具有重要意义。

    总之,数据库建表是关系型数据库中的重要环节,它可以为数据存储、组织、约束、查询和分析提供支持,对于数据管理和应用开发都起到了至关重要的作用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部